About

Understanding Medical Research - Your Facebook Friend is Wrong offered by Coursera in partnership with Yale, will provide you with the tools and skills you need to critically interpret medical studies, and determine for yourself the difference between good and bad science.

Overview

The Understanding Medical Research - Your Facebook Friend is Wrong offered by Coursera in partnership with Yale covers study-design, research methods, and statistical interpretation. It also delves into the dark side of medical research by covering  fraud, biases, and common misinterpretations of data. Each lesson will highlight case-studies from real-world journal articles.

By the end of this course, you'll have the tools you need to determine the trustworthiness of the scientific information you're reading and, of course, whether or not your Facebook friend is wrong.

What you will learn

  • How to efficiently read a medical research paper and how to differentiate between good and bad research
  • The different tests used in medical research and how to spot common errors in methodology and interoperation for each
  • Read and understand statistical figures, charts, and graphics
  • How best to verify claims made in news articles

Programme Structure

Courses include:

  • Welcome!
  • The Basics
  • Medical Statistics Made Ridiculously Simple
  • Types of Medical Studies
  • How Wrong Conclusions Are Reached
  • Bias
  • Fixing the Problems with Medical Studies
